reddit why does the emergence of verbal language skills conicide with episodic memory and thus the disappearance of infantile amnesia

Answers

Answer 1

The emergence of verbal language skills coincides with episodic memory and the disappearance of infantile amnesia because language enables encoding and retrieval of memories, facilitating the retention of personal experiences in later childhood and beyond.

Verbal language allows individuals to encode and express their experiences in a structured and coherent manner. As language skills improve, children can narrate and discuss their personal experiences, which enhances their ability to form and retain episodic memories.

Language provides a framework for organizing and consolidating memories, as well as retrieving and recounting them later. Moreover, verbal communication with others, such as parents and caregivers, helps reinforce and reinforce the memories, creating a social context for memory formation and retention.

Therefore, the development of language skills plays a significant role in the disappearance of infantile amnesia and the emergence of episodic memory.

AP Psychology Psychotherapies have many common ingredients. Identify three commonly agree upon benefits of psychotherapies

Answers

All types of psychotherapy seem to offer three benefits: new hope, a fresh perspective, and an empathic, trusting, caring relationship. Therapists do, however, differ in the values that influence their aims. This makes it important for people seeking therapy to find someone they are comfortable with.

Under the doctrine of strict liability, if there is no fault, there is no liability.a. Trueb. False

Answers

The statement "Under the doctrine of strict liability, if there is no fault, there is no liability" is a FALSE statement. Therefore, the correct answer is option B.

Strict liability is a standard of liability, under which a person is legally responsible for the consequences of an activity even when they don't have any intent or fault in the activity. This standard exists in criminal and civil law. In short, this standard exists regardless of the defendant's intent or mental state when they are committing the action.
